Best way to plot the change of incidence of disease over time –
**Core Concept**
The question is testing the understanding of epidemiological data analysis, specifically the appropriate method for displaying the change in disease incidence over time. **Incidence** refers to the number of new cases of a disease that occur within a specified time period among a population at risk.
**Why the Correct Answer is Right**
To plot the change in disease incidence over time, a **line graph** is the most suitable option. This is because a line graph can effectively show the trend of incidence rates over different time periods, allowing for easy visualization of changes and patterns. In epidemiology, line graphs are commonly used to display time-series data, enabling researchers to identify trends, peaks, and troughs in disease incidence.
